Ultimate rib of Beef with rosemary and garlic roast potatoes
Ingredients
- 1x rosemary-roasted cubed potato recipe
- zest and juice 1 lemon
- zest and juice 1 lemon
- a small bunch of fresh rosemary, tied together at the base.
- olive oil
- 1 × 1.2kg/2lb 11oz rib of beef
- peppery extra virgin olive oil
- a sprig of fresh rosemary
- olive oil or duck or goose fat
Directions
- Put the garlic, lemon zest and the tip of the rosemary brush in a pestle and mortar
- add a glug of olive oil and bash together
- use the rosemary brush to rub half the marinade over the rib steaks
- marinate for at least an hour
- preheat oven to 200 deg Celcius and get your potatoes parboiled and in the oven
- heat an ovenproof griddle pan on the hob until white-hot
- season your steak generously
- put them in the pan and fry for a couple of minutes before turning them over
- put the pan in the oven for 20 minutes for medium
- every 5 minutes turn the steaks over and baste them with some of the remaining
- marinade using your rosemary brush
- when done, remove from the oven, squeeze over a little lemon juice and let the steaks rest for 5 minutes
- serve with the roasted potatoes
